Rate and Efficiency



GalvoLaser Galvo
Making the most of rate and efficiency is critical when selecting a galvo for your jobs. The rate of a galvo is normally identified by its response time and scanning speed, both of which establish the efficiency of the system.


High-speed galvos allow faster handling times, which is necessary for making the most of throughput in production atmospheres. When reviewing galvos, take into consideration the optimum angular velocity, typically determined in degrees per 2nd, in addition to the clearing up time, which affects exactly how promptly the system can maintain after a command. Furthermore, the acceleration capabilities of the galvo play a significant role in accomplishing optimum performance, specifically in applications including complex trajectories or high-density patterns.


In addition, the functional data transfer ought to be examined, as it determines the series of frequencies at which the galvo can effectively operate. Eventually, picking a galvo that lines up with your particular rate and efficiency demands will ensure that your projects attain the preferred performance and efficiency.


Accuracy and Resolution



When picking a galvo for accuracy applications,Accomplishing high precision and resolution is basic. The precision of a galvo system is usually defined by its capacity to place the laser beam specifically at the preferred coordinates. Laser Galvo. This accuracy is extremely important in applications such as laser inscription, marking, and cutting, where even small deviations can bring about substantial high quality concerns


Resolution, on the various other hand, describes the smallest distinct attribute that the galvo can produce. It is important in establishing the level of detail possible in the final result. Higher resolution enables the reproduction of detailed designs with fine information, making it essential for sectors that require high-quality outcomes, such as medical gadget production and microelectronics.


When assessing a galvo's precision and resolution, think about requirements such as angular resolution and linearity. A reduced angular resolution indicates much better accuracy, while linearity guarantees that the system acts naturally across its whole functional range. Comprehending these parameters makes it possible for informed decision-making in selecting a galvo that fulfills the details requirements of your job, making certain optimal performance and top quality in last results.
